Understanding Server Cloud Computing: The Backbone of Modern Technology

In today’s fast-paced digital world, businesses and individuals increasingly rely on server cloud computing to manage data, applications, and services. But what exactly is server cloud computing, and why has it become a critical component of modern technology? This article delves deep into the world of server cloud computing, exploring its features, benefits, applications, and future trends.

What is Server Cloud Computing?

Server cloud computing refers to the delivery of computing resources—including servers, storage, databases, networking, software, and analytics—over the internet, or “the cloud.” Unlike traditional on-premises servers, which require physical hardware, maintenance, and extensive IT support, cloud servers are hosted in data centers and accessed remotely. This allows organizations to scale resources dynamically, reduce costs, and improve operational efficiency.

At its core, server cloud computing eliminates the need for companies to invest in large IT infrastructure. Instead, they can rent virtual servers from cloud providers like Amazon Web Services (AWS), Microsoft Azure, Google Cloud Platform (GCP), and others. These virtual servers function just like physical servers but offer enhanced flexibility, speed, and global accessibility.

How Server Cloud Computing Works

Server cloud computing operates on virtualization technology. Virtualization allows a single physical server to host multiple virtual servers, each running its own operating system and applications. This ensures optimal utilization of hardware resources and reduces wasted capacity.

Cloud providers maintain large data centers with thousands of physical servers connected through high-speed networks. Users can deploy virtual servers in these data centers through self-service portals or APIs. Key components of server cloud computing include:

  1. Compute Resources: Virtual servers provide processing power (CPU), memory (RAM), and storage to run applications.

  2. Networking: Cloud servers are connected via virtual networks, ensuring secure data transfer and connectivity.

  3. Storage Solutions: Cloud storage can range from object storage for unstructured data to block storage for databases.

  4. Management Tools: Users can monitor, scale, and manage virtual servers through dashboards or automation scripts.

Types of Server Cloud Computing Services

Server cloud computing can be categorized into three primary service models:

1. Infrastructure as a Service (IaaS)

IaaS offers virtualized computing resources over the internet. Users can provision virtual servers, storage, and networking without investing in physical hardware. IaaS provides flexibility, as businesses can scale resources up or down according to demand. Popular IaaS providers include AWS EC2, Microsoft Azure Virtual Machines, and Google Compute Engine.

2. Platform as a Service (PaaS)

PaaS provides a platform allowing developers to build, deploy, and manage applications without worrying about underlying infrastructure. It includes development tools, databases, middleware, and runtime environments. Examples of PaaS include Google App Engine, Microsoft Azure App Service, and Heroku.

3. Software as a Service (SaaS)

SaaS delivers software applications over the internet, eliminating the need for local installation. Cloud servers host these applications, and users access them through web browsers or APIs. Examples include Microsoft 365, Salesforce, and Zoom.

Advantages of Server Cloud Computing

Server cloud computing offers numerous benefits that make it appealing to businesses, startups, and individual users:

1. Cost Efficiency

Cloud servers reduce the need for costly physical infrastructure and IT maintenance. Users pay only for the resources they consume, making cloud computing a cost-effective solution for businesses of all sizes.

2. Scalability

With server cloud computing, resources can be scaled up or down based on demand. During peak traffic periods, additional virtual servers can be provisioned instantly, ensuring performance and reliability.

3. Global Accessibility

Cloud servers can be accessed from anywhere with an internet connection, enabling remote work, collaboration, and global expansion.

4. Reliability and Redundancy

Top cloud providers maintain multiple data centers with failover mechanisms, ensuring high uptime and disaster recovery. Data is often replicated across multiple servers to prevent loss.

5. Security

Cloud providers implement advanced security protocols, including encryption, access controls, and monitoring. Many providers also comply with industry standards such as GDPR, HIPAA, and ISO certifications.

Applications of Server Cloud Computing

The versatility of server cloud computing allows it to power a wide range of applications across industries:

1. Web Hosting and Development

Cloud servers enable developers to deploy websites and web applications quickly. Virtual servers offer flexibility in terms of operating systems, databases, and web server configurations.

2. Big Data Analytics

Businesses can leverage cloud servers to process and analyze massive datasets. Cloud computing allows for real-time analytics, enabling data-driven decision-making and predictive insights.

3. Artificial Intelligence and Machine Learning

AI and ML workloads require significant computational power, which cloud servers provide on-demand. Users can train models, perform data analysis, and deploy intelligent applications without owning expensive hardware.

4. Gaming and Streaming Services

Cloud gaming platforms and streaming services use server cloud computing to deliver high-quality experiences. Cloud servers handle heavy rendering, low-latency connections, and content delivery across regions.

5. Enterprise Applications

ERP, CRM, and other enterprise applications run efficiently on cloud servers. Businesses benefit from seamless updates, scalability, and enhanced collaboration features.

Trends Shaping the Future of Server Cloud Computing

Server cloud computing continues to evolve rapidly. Emerging trends include:

1. Multi-Cloud and Hybrid Cloud Strategies

Organizations are increasingly adopting multi-cloud (using services from multiple providers) and hybrid cloud (combining private and public clouds) strategies to optimize costs, security, and performance.

2. Edge Computing Integration

Edge computing brings computation closer to the data source, reducing latency and bandwidth use. Cloud providers are integrating edge computing with server cloud computing to support IoT, autonomous vehicles, and real-time analytics.

3. Serverless Computing

Serverless computing abstracts server management entirely, allowing developers to focus on code execution rather than infrastructure. Cloud providers dynamically allocate resources based on workload, enhancing efficiency.

4. Green Cloud Computing

Sustainability is becoming a priority. Cloud providers are investing in energy-efficient data centers and renewable energy sources to reduce the carbon footprint of server cloud computing.

5. Enhanced Security and Compliance

As cyber threats evolve, cloud providers are introducing advanced AI-driven security tools, zero-trust architectures, and compliance certifications to ensure secure cloud operations.

Choosing the Right Server Cloud Computing Provider

Selecting the ideal cloud provider requires evaluating several factors:

  • Performance: Look for low-latency servers and robust infrastructure to meet your application needs.

  • Cost: Compare pricing models, including pay-as-you-go and reserved instances, to optimize budget.

  • Security: Ensure the provider offers encryption, identity management, and compliance certifications.

  • Support: 24/7 customer support and comprehensive documentation are critical for seamless operations.

  • Scalability and Flexibility: Choose a provider that allows easy scaling and supports various services and technologies.

Conclusion

Server cloud computing has revolutionized how organizations and individuals approach computing resources. Its flexibility, scalability, cost efficiency, and global accessibility make it an indispensable part of modern technology. As businesses increasingly adopt cloud strategies, understanding the nuances of server cloud computing becomes essential. Whether you are a startup, a large enterprise, or a tech enthusiast, leveraging cloud servers can unlock new opportunities, streamline operations, and drive innovation in the digital era.